Application deadlines for Border Studies Fall 2011 and Spring 2012 is March 15, 2011. If there are still spaces available for the spring program, there will be a second deadline of October 15, 2011.

You may apply by downloading the application (see below), by requesting an application from the program at borders@earlham.edu, or by checking in the Study Abroad Office on your campus.

Note: The Spanish writing sample is required only for the Spring Program applicants.
